The Context: From Messaging to Settlement
LayerZero has spent years positioning itself as the messaging layer of the multi-chain stack. Its omnichain interoperability protocol connects over seventy chains, and its ecosystem includes major DeFi protocols, NFT platforms, and institutional players. The company has raised substantial capital from top-tier venture funds, and its founder has become a prominent voice in the interoperability debate. The protocol's architecture relies on a novel combination of oracles and relayers to verify cross-chain messages โ a design that has been both praised for its pragmatism and criticized for its trust assumptions.
Now, with ATLAS, LayerZero claims to be moving from messaging to settlement. But what does that actually mean? Settlement in traditional finance is the final transfer of assets and the completion of a transaction. It is the moment when the buyer receives the asset, the seller receives the payment, and the transaction becomes irreversible. In the traditional world, settlement is handled by clearinghouses, central securities depositories, and a complex web of correspondent banks. It is slow, expensive, and opaque. The T+2 settlement cycle in US equities is a legacy of this infrastructure.
In crypto, settlement is a contested concept. Finality โ the point at which a transaction cannot be reversed โ varies wildly across chains. Bitcoin's probabilistic finality means you wait for confirmations. Ethereum's Casper mechanism provides economic finality after a certain number of epochs. Solana's Proof of History provides fast but not absolute finality. When you move assets across chains, you are not just moving information โ you are coordinating state transitions across different finality models. This is the settlement problem.
The Core: What a Settlement Engine Actually Requires
Let me break down what a settlement engine actually requires, what LayerZero has delivered so far, and why the market's reaction reveals more about the current cycle than about ATLAS itself.
First, the technical gap. A settlement engine is not a messaging protocol. Messaging is the transport layer โ it moves information between chains. Settlement is the state transition layer โ it ensures that assets are actually transferred, that finality is achieved, and that the economic consequences of a cross-chain transaction are irreversible. These are fundamentally different problems with fundamentally different security requirements.
LayerZero's existing architecture uses oracles and relayers to verify cross-chain messages. The oracle provides the block header, the relayer provides the transaction proof, and the protocol checks that both agree. This is a 2-of-3 trust model โ if the oracle and relayer collude, they can submit fraudulent messages. The protocol has been audited multiple times, and its security model is well-documented. But it is not a settlement engine. It is a message verification system.
ATLAS, if it is to be a settlement engine, would need to address the finality problem. How do you know that a transaction on Chain A is truly final before you release assets on Chain B? This is the atomicity problem โ the requirement that a cross-chain transaction either completes on all chains or completes on none. Atomic swaps have tried to solve this with hash time-locked contracts, but they have significant limitations. Optimistic bridging uses fraud proofs, but it introduces a challenge period. zk-bridging uses zero-knowledge proofs, but it requires significant computational overhead.
LayerZero has not published any technical details about how ATLAS would address these problems. No consensus mechanism. No fraud proof system. No optimistic verification scheme. No zk-proof integration. The absence of technical detail is not merely a gap โ it is a signal. In my experience auditing protocols during the 2017 ICO cycle, I learned that teams with real technical breakthroughs publish early. They want scrutiny. They want the community to validate their architecture. The teams that publish names without mechanisms are either protecting a competitive advantage or protecting an absence.
Based on my audit experience, I would estimate that a genuine cross-chain settlement engine requires at least eighteen to twenty-four months of development, including formal verification of the finality logic, extensive testnet deployment, and multiple independent security audits. The fact that LayerZero announced ATLAS without any of these artifacts suggests either that the project is in its earliest conceptual phase, or that the announcement is primarily a strategic signal rather than a technical disclosure.
Second, the token economics question. ZRO's 10% jump on the announcement suggests the market is pricing in a new value-capture mechanism. But the announcement says nothing about fees, burning, staking, or any other mechanism that would connect ATLAS usage to ZRO demand. The market is essentially writing the tokenomics itself. This is a dangerous form of collective fiction.
I have seen this pattern before. In 2020, during DeFi Summer, protocols announced "v2" upgrades with no tokenomics details, and the market priced in speculative value that never materialized. The liquidity pool is a mirror, not a vault โ it reflects what the market believes, not what the protocol delivers. When a protocol announces a new product without specifying how it will generate revenue or capture value for the token, the market fills in the blanks with the most optimistic assumptions. This is not analysis; it is projection.
Let me be specific about what ATLAS would need to do to create value for ZRO holders. It would need to either: charge fees for settlement services, with a portion of those fees burned or distributed to stakers; require ZRO staking as a security deposit for validators or relayers; or create a governance mechanism where ZRO holders control the parameters of the settlement engine. None of these mechanisms have been announced. The market is pricing in all of them simultaneously.
Third, the competitive landscape. Wormhole has been building settlement infrastructure. Axelar has positioned itself as a general-purpose cross-chain communication layer with strong Cosmos integration. The cross-chain space is crowded, and the differentiation is increasingly about security assumptions and finality guarantees. LayerZero's existing model relies on a 2-of-3 trust assumption between oracles, relayers, and the protocol itself. If ATLAS is built on the same trust model, it is not a settlement engine โ it is a settlement suggestion.
The competitive dynamics here are worth examining in detail. Wormhole has the advantage of being battle-tested โ it has processed billions of dollars in cross-chain volume and has survived multiple security incidents. Axelar has the advantage of deep Cosmos integration and a more decentralized validator set. LayerZero has the advantage of the largest ecosystem of integrations and the strongest brand recognition in the interoperability space. But brand recognition does not solve the finality problem.

The Contrarian Angle: The Market Is Not Overreacting
Here is the counter-intuitive angle. The market's reaction to ATLAS is not irrational โ it is a rational response to an information vacuum. When there is no technical detail, the market prices the best-case scenario. This is the opposite of what most analysts assume. The market is not overreacting; it is optimally pricing an unknown by assigning it maximum optionality. The real risk is not the announcement โ it is the subsequent disclosure. When the whitepaper finally drops, the market will have to compress that optionality into a specific technical reality. That compression is where the volatility will come from.
This is a subtle but important point. In information economics, the value of an option increases with uncertainty. ATLAS is a call option on LayerZero's execution capability. The market is paying a premium for this option because the uncertainty is high. When the whitepaper is released, the uncertainty will decrease, and the option value will decrease with it. This means that the price reaction to the whitepaper could be negative even if the whitepaper is technically sound โ simply because the market was pricing maximum optionality.
